Amazon billionaire Jeff Bezos has reportedly mentioned the potential for becoming a member of a consortium which is pushing to purchase a stake in Premier League giants Liverpool.
British-Indian businessman Amit Bhatia is main a bunch of financiers which is in talks to make a ‘strategic minority funding’ in Liverpool.
As reported by Every day Mail Sport on Tuesday, Bhatia, the son-in-law of Indian billionaire Lakshmi Mittal, is pushing for a cope with homeowners Fenway Sports activities Group that might take the membership’s worth above £4.5billion ($6bn).
Now, although, Sky News reports that Bezos has been approached to affix the consortium and has held discussions about working with Bhatia and Co. FSG and Bezos have been approached for remark.
It stays unsure whether or not the 62-year-old will assist fund a stake within the Premier League staff. Bezos is ranked by Forbes because the fourth richest man on the planet. He has a web value of $256.9billion.
As reported by Sky Information, the Amazon founder has beforehand thought-about bidding for the Seattle Seahawks – the reigning Tremendous Bowl champions – and their NFL rivals, the Washington Commanders.

However on neither event did Bezos proceed with a deal.
Bhatia, in the meantime, was co-owner at Championship facet Queens Park Rangers. He has a stand named after him on the membership’s stadium, Loftus Highway, however surprisingly stepped down from the QPR possession setup on Tuesday.
A spokesperson for Fenway Sports activities Group mentioned in a press release: ‘An funding consortium led, managed, and represented by Amit Bhatia has expressed curiosity in making a strategic minority funding in Liverpool Soccer Membership.’
Nothing is official but and, if it was to proceed, it will comply with an analogous construction to a deal made three years in the past when FSG bought a small stake to sports activities funding agency Dynasty.
